Description
The United Reformed Church and adjoining manse, originally built in 1821, is a chapel, manse, and school that was enlarged in the mid to late 19th century and altered in the late 20th century. The building is rendered and features a gable front with a valley in between, along with bitumen-covered slate roofs and a corrugated iron lean-to addition on the right. The layout consists of the chapel in the center, the manse on the left, and the school on the right.
It is two storeys high with a façade of one to three bays. The left gable end has 20th-century windows, while the right side has a string course at the base of the gable and a plaque in the apex inscribed 'Built AD 1821'. The chapel has semicircular headed sash windows with glazing bars, and the main entrance is through a flat-roofed wooden porch with chamfered corners and a double floor. The left side features an open pedimented pilaster doorcase with a fanlight and a plain door, while the right side has a cantilevered porch supported by shaped console brackets, leading to another plain door. There is also a tablet inscribed 'E.N. Welin' at ground level. The right return has three bays with 16-pane sash windows. The open pilaster doorcase originally belonged to the chapel door but was relocated to the manse when the porch was added. The interior has not been seen.
